Q: Is 2,616,544 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,616,544 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,616,544 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2616544 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 8 14 16 28 32 56 112 224 11,681 23,362 46,724 81,767 93,448 163,534 186,896 327,068 373,792 654,136 1,308,272 and 2,616,544, with no remainder.

Since 2,616,544 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,616,544, it is not a prime number.
